Phi-Phi

Phi-Phi is a French light operetta in three acts, with music by Henri Christiné and a libretto by Albert Willemetz and Fabien Solar. It premiered at Paris's Théâtre des Bouffes-Parisiens in November 1918, shortly after the Armistice. Dédé

Dédé is a French operetta in three acts, with music by Henri Christiné and a libretto by Albert Willemetz. It premiered at the Théâtre des Bouffes-Parisiens in Paris on 10 November 1921, with Maurice Chevalier among the original performers.
